About Us

David Yurman is a celebrated American jewelry company founded in New York by David Yurman, a sculptor, and his wife, Sybil, a painter and ceramicist. When the artists began collaborating, their goal was simply to make beautiful objects to wear. Led today by their son Evan, David Yurman creates timeless, yet contemporary collections for women and men defined by inspiration, innovation, consummate craftsmanship and cable – the brand’s artistic signature. David Yurman collections are available at retail stores throughout the United States, Canada, Hong Kong and France and at locations worldwide, through their exclusive authorized fine jewelry and timepiece network of retailers.

Job Description

Summary:

This role is the designated Human Resources Business Partner (HRBP) for the retail population of the Central US (locations below). As part of the Retail HRBP team, you will be responsible for planning and implementing People & Culture related policies, programs, and practices that produce a high-performance culture and ensure the Company’s goals for the Retail Division are met. You will support talent development, mitigate employee relations issues, enhance employee experience and support recruitment as the point-of-contact for all HR matters in your region.

Please note: This is a field based role that will be required to visit Central US based retail stores frequently, often with limited advance notice. Ideal candidates will live within close proximity to the following locations:

  • Atlanta, GA
  • Chicago, IL
  • St. Louis, MO
  • Troy, MI
  • Edina, MN
  • Columbus, OH
  • Indianapolis, IN
  • Texas (Austin, Houston, Dallas, or San Antonio)

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ree and 3-5 years of hands-on HR experience, preferably independently managing a population
  • Knowledge of fundamental HR practices – employee relations, talent development, performance management, recruitment, compensation benefits, employment law
  • Familiar with HR systems – Workday, LinkedIn Recruiter, digital learning platforms
  • Excellent communication presentation skills
  • Willingness and ability to travel frequently, often with limited advance notice

Responsibilities:

  • Employee relations:
    • Work proactively with Retail management to minimize employee relations issues
    • When needed, conduct investigations or interventions to mitigate/resolve problems
    • Approve and administer disciplinary actions
    • Partner with senior management and legal on cases – recommend action plans
    • Ensure adherence with all HR policies, as well as employment-related legal, regulatory and compliance requirements
  • Talent development
    • Lead Annual Review process for region – manage consistency and completion
    • Partner with managers throughout year to monitor and improve employee performance
    • Support promotions, career path mapping and succession planning
    • Work with Learning & Development to assess needs (new hires, people managers, ongoing development), shape content and champion platforms with teams
  • Recruitment & exits
    • Source, interview and assess retail talent
    • Specific focus on pipelining for staffing new stores and/or key roles
    • Coach managers on hiring best practices
    • Conduct exit interviews and log/analyze/report on meaningful feedback and retention/turnover data
    • Support onboarding and offboarding operations with payroll/benefits, IT, L&D, loss prevention, etc.
  • People operations
    • Work with Compensation team on ensuring competitive package offerings per location and Benefits team to publicize and market robust offerings to staff
    • Work with Finance team and Retail Operations on headcount planning per store
    • Keep HRIS system (Workday) up-to-date, help users as needed
    • Ensure parity in policies, practices and standards
    • Identify and implement programming to optimize the retail employee experience
Estimated Base Salary: $95,000 - $115,000

Base pay is one component of David Yurman’s total compensation package, which may also include the following for eligible employees: access to healthcare benefits, 401(k) plan, bonus, employee discounts, Summer Fridays (corporate roles), generous paid time off, sick time, and more.
